Frequently asked questions

What should I write in a Congratulations New Baby Wishes card?

Address both the baby and the new parents — most cards forget the parents and become generic 'welcome to the world' notes. A line about the baby (welcome, what kind of life is waiting) plus a line about the parents (how their love just multiplied, that the tired weeks are worth it) makes the card actually useful. Should the card be for the baby or for the parents?

Both, in that order. New parents are running on no sleep and don't need a long card about themselves; the baby is the obvious reason for writing, so name it first, then add the line for the parents. Can I personalise these Congratulations New Baby Wishes with the recipient's name?

Yes — and using the baby's name (once it's chosen) is the single best edit. Most wishes here are written before the baby has a name, so swapping 'the baby' for 'Amelia' or 'little Theo' shifts the whole tone toward something the family will keep.
